Job Summary:
The Store Manager / Facility Manager will oversee the operations of the central store. The ideal candidate will be responsible for supervising storekeepers, monitor material usage to prevent waste and theft, and ensure accurate record-keeping. In this role, you are required to have strong organizational skills, proficiency with software and technology for centralized inventory management, and the ability to implement efficient storekeeping processes that minimize losses and optimize inventory control.
Responsibilities
- Manage and oversee the daily operations of the central store.
- Supervise and guide storekeepers, ensuring adherence to procedures and policies.
- Monitor material usage and maintain accurate inventory records to minimize waste, loss, and theft.
- Utilize software tools to manage and improve storekeeping systems.
- Develop and implement efficient inventory control processes.
- Ensure compliance with organizational standards, policies, and best practices.
- Prepare and present regular reports on stock levels, material utilization, and store performance.
- Collaborate with procurement, finance, and operations teams to ensure smooth coordination of activities.
- Maintain a safe, organized, and hazard-free store environment.
- Lead, train, and evaluate store staff to support efficiency and continuous improvement.
- Identify and implement cost-saving initiatives within store operations.
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in a relevant field.
- 8–10 years of proven experience in store management, inventory control, or facility management.
- Strong experience using software/technology to manage centralized inventory systems.
- In-depth knowledge of storekeeping practices, material handling, and record management.
- Excellent leadership and supervisory skills with the ability to manage and motivate teams
- Strong organizational, analytical, and problem-solving skills.
- High attention to detail, integrity, and accountability
- Ability to work under pressure and manage multiple priorities effectively.
